A slightly distant starboard side view, taken from ahead of the beam, of the Leyland Line passenger liner and cruise ship Belgenland (1917) anchored off an unidentified coast. She is dressed overall, her forward accommodation ladder is down and lifeboats have been launched. A tender with a partially obscured number 'A 374?' is alongside amidships and a number of bumboats are also alongside.
The Belgenland undertook a number of Mediterranean cruises in the early 1930s. Negatives numbers P83422, P83425 and P83426 were taken on the same occasion.
